'Silence Of The Lambs' director Jonathan Demme dies aged 73
He also helmed Philadelphia, The Manchurian Candidate and Rachel Getting Married.

Demme replaces Scorsese on Bob Marley documentary
Jonathan Demme has replaced Martin Scorsese as director on Tuff Gong Pictures and Shangri-La Entertainment's Bob Marley documentary.The untitled film will be released worldwide on February 6 2010, marking the 65th anniversary of the reggae icon's birth.
